About the Community
A for-profit corporation, Prestige Gardens Rehabilitation and Nursing Center accepts Medicare and Medicaid. The facility contains 99 beds with an average occupancy rate of 72.1%.
Resident council is available. Prestige Gardens Rehabilitation and Nursing Center is not a continuing care retirement community.
The most recent standard fire safety inspection saw automatic sprinklers in all required areas.
